The document discusses documenting the evaluation section of a SOAP note. It explains that in the evaluation section, the healthcare professional lists the patient's problem areas at the impairment, functional, and disability levels. They also determine the patient's diagnosis and prognosis. The therapist reviews the history, systems review, and tests and measures to identify functional deficits and impairments. They then list these and explain the relationship between the impairments, deficits, and disability levels. An example is provided of linking specific impairments to functional deficits and how improving the impairments could lead to increased function.
